4. Relative tightness
4.1 By deformation
As with absolute sealing, bellows or deformable membranes are used, but these are made from elastomers. As these materials are not totally impermeable, very small leakage is possible, especially with gases.
Elastomer bellows (figure 11 ) are flexible, compressible containers used mainly as a means of protection against dust and splashes, as their resistance to pressure is very low.
